Which of the following is a polymer made up of nucleotides?
A
DNA, RNA
B
Starch, Glycogen
C
Enzymes, Antibodies
D
Triglycerides, Steroids
Explanation: 

Detailed explanation-1: -DNA and RNA molecules are polymers made up of long chains of nucleotides.

Detailed explanation-2: -The polymer of nucleotides is called RNA (Ribonucleic acid) and DNA (Deoxyribonucleic acid). Both nucleic acids RNA and DNA consist of Polymer of nucleotides.

Detailed explanation-3: -DNA consists of two long polymers (called strands) that run in opposite directions and form the regular geometry of the double helix. The monomers of DNA are called nucleotides. Nucleotides have three components: a base, a sugar (deoxyribose) and a phosphate residue.

Detailed explanation-4: -RNA is a linear polymer of nucleotides linked by a ribose-phosphate backbone. Polymerization of nucleotides occurs in a condensation reaction in which phosphodiester bonds are formed.

Detailed explanation-5: -Deoxyribonucleic acid (DNA) and ribonucleic acid (RNA) are polymers composed of monomers called nucleotides. An RNA nucleotide consists of a five-carbon sugar phosphate linked to one of four nucleic acid bases: guanine (G), cytosine (C), adenine (A) and uracil (U).
